Cheonan Buldang-dong sushi with washed aged kimchi: Ganghan Sushi
In short
Ganghan Sushi Cheonan Buldang Branch is a Japanese sushi restaurant in Buldang-dong, Cheonan, well suited to eating a sushi set alone. The 12-piece omakase sushi set came with cold soba on the side, and everything from the halibut fin sushi eaten with washed aged kimchi (mugeunji) to the uni and monkfish liver gunkan was satisfying. The cold soba was more than one person needs, but fresh ingredients and a full spread made it a filling meal.

What comes in the 12-piece omakase sushi set with cold soba
Omakase Sushi (₩23,000)
I wanted cool soba with my omakase sushi so I swapped it to cold soba! I changed it to soba but by mistake(?) they also gave me the regular udon too haha


First up, miso soup and seafood croquette, yum~~ The croquette is totally crispy and delicious haha
It's 12 pieces so the portion is the same as one serving, but the sushi lineup is luxurious and amazing!! It's made up entirely of top-grade sushi haha
Halibut fin and fresh salmon sushi at Ganghan Sushi
First we start with the white fish sushi!! It's halibut sushi made using extra-large halibut over 3kg from Wando.
This is halibut fin sushi. It's got a lot of fat so the savory flavor and distinctive crunchy texture are ㅠ art!!! ㅠ I topped one with washed aged kimchi~

My favorite salmon sushi is made from top-grade 7kg superior grade fresh salmon! The salmon was in such good condition that I ate one without the onion sauce haha

Tuna sushi~ This is the inner meat of premium honmaguro over 200kg! Doesn't the bright red color look so delicious?

Tuna belly sushi! It's swordfish belly with subtle marbling. The more you chew, the more the fatty richness and chewy texture shine ㅠㅠ Okay, now the second half is the sushi with stronger seasoning haha


Fresh uni piled generously on top of chewy sweet shrimp. The rich sweetness of the shrimp blends with the creamy, deep ocean flavor of the uni, and it was genuinely so delicious!!!! Uni is the best ㅠ absolutely amazing

House-made soy-marinated shrimp aged carefully for 24 hours. I was worried it might be too salty so I saved it for last, but the seasoning was just right and the shrimp was plump and firm~
Anyone who likes gamtae (dried seaweed flakes)~ gamtae is everything. It's a fragrant gamtae and fresh raw beef tartare gunkan. Do I even need to say how well gamtae pairs with raw fish haha


Soft abalone sushi eaten together with rich, savory abalone innard sauce. I love this kind of briny organ dish, and eating them together doubled the flavor.

And of course this monkfish liver gunkan? Totally my style~ It's packed full of monkfish liver, called the foie gras of the sea. Soft and insanely savory ㅠ
The last one is eel sushi with plenty of smoky char. It chews soft with no small bones, sweet and salty, a perfect finale.

How the cold soba and washed aged kimchi pair with the sushi
Cold soba with a lightly icy tsuyu broth, grated radish, and savory toppings. It wasn't salty or overpowering, the seasoning was just right. It was a broth that brought out the flavor of the sushi even more. The buckwheat noodles were cooked well without going mushy, keeping a chewy texture!

And you know how at conveyor belt sushi places you occasionally get aged kimchi sushi in between? Since they give you washed aged kimchi here, I ended up eating this more than the pickled radish, more than expected lol. Aged kimchi really was the master stroke!
